President Volodymyr Zelensky said on Aug. 12 that Kyiv’s operation in Russia’s Kursk Oblast is a “catastrophe” for Russian President Vladimir Putin and his full-scale war against Ukraine. Zelensky’s evening address came after Ukraine’s Commander-in-Chief Oleksandr Syrskyi reported that Ukrainian forces control abound 1,000 square kilometers in Kursk Oblast as their incursion continues into its seventh day.
